High power deep ultraviolet (UV) radiation has attracted much attention in areas such as photo-lithography. We report progress in improving the quality of Czochralski-grown /spl beta/-BaB/sub 2/O/sub 4/ (BBO) which is essential for generating high average output power in the deep ultraviolet regime. In order to evaluate our CZ grown BBO, a flash-lamp pumped Q-switched Nd:YAG laser (Quantel YG-682S) was employed.
